Since the factory installed its new ventilation system, reported respiratory complaints among workers have fallen by half. No other change to working conditions coincided with this decline, and the drop appeared immediately after installation rather than accumulating gradually. The most plausible account, then, is that the ventilation system, and not some unrelated background trend, is responsible for the improvement in workers' respiratory health.

Which one of the following most accurately expresses the main conclusion of the argument?

  1. Since the new ventilation system was in fact installed, reported respiratory complaints among workers have fallen by half, during the first six months after the ventilation system began operating.
  2. The new ventilation system has eliminated respiratory complaints among the factory's workers.
  3. The new ventilation system, and not some unrelated background trend, is responsible for the improvement in workers' respiratory health.
  4. The decline in complaints appeared immediately after installation rather than accumulating gradually.
  5. The factory's respiratory health improved because its production volume fell after installation.
